Understanding the IELTS Academic Certificate: A Comprehensive Guide
The International English Language Testing System (IELTS) is an internationally acknowledged English language efficiency test for non-native English speakers. It is widely accepted by universities, employers, and migration authorities in numerous countries, especially in the UK, Australia, Canada, and New Zealand. The IELTS Academic test is particularly created for trainees who wish to study at the undergraduate or postgraduate levels in an English-speaking environment. This post supplies a comprehensive summary of the IELTS Academic certificate, including its structure, scoring, and the advantages of getting this credential.
What is the IELTS Academic Test?
The IELTS Academic test is one of the 2 primary variations of the IELTS exam, the other being the IELTS General Training test. The Academic variation is customized for individuals who prepare to request college or expert registration in an English-speaking nation. The test assesses the prospect's ability to comprehend and utilize academic English in a range of contexts, including lectures, workshops, and composed projects.
Structure of the IELTS Academic Test
The IELTS Academic test consists of 4 areas: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. Each area is designed to examine different elements of English language proficiency.
Listening (30 minutes)
The Listening area consists of four tape-recorded passages, ranging from monologues to discussions, followed by 40 questions. The passages are typically embeded in daily social contexts and instructional settings.Skills Assessed: Understanding main points, specific details, and the speaker's attitude or viewpoint.
Checking out (60 minutes)
The Reading section consists of three long texts, which might be detailed, accurate, or discursive. The texts are drawn from books, journals, publications, and papers.Skills Assessed: Reading for essence, essences, detail, and comprehending rational arguments.
Composing (60 minutes)
The Writing section includes 2 tasks:Task 1: Candidates are asked to describe, sum up, or discuss information presented in a chart, table, chart, or diagram. They must compose at least 150 words.Job 2: Candidates are asked to write an essay in reaction to a point of view, argument, or problem. They need to write at least 250 words.Skills Assessed: Writing for a function, using suitable tone and design, and organizing concepts coherently.
Speaking (11-14 minutes)
The Speaking section is a face-to-face interview with an examiner. It includes three parts:Part 1: Introduction and interview (4-5 minutes)Part 2: Long turn (3-4 minutes), where the candidate discusses a given topicPart 3: Discussion (4-5 minutes), where the prospect talks about more abstract issues related to the topic in Part 2Abilities Assessed: Speaking with complete confidence, utilizing a wide variety of vocabulary, and revealing and validating viewpoints.Scoring and Band Scores
The IELTS Academic test is scored on a scale of 0 to 9, with 9 being the highest. Each area (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king) is scored separately, and the general band score is the average of these four scores. The scores are reported in half-band increments.

University Admissions:
Many universities and colleges in English-speaking countries need an IELTS Academic certificate as evidence of English efficiency. A good score can significantly improve a student's application and increase their possibilities of approval.
Professional Registration:
Certain expert bodies and regulative organizations need an IELTS Academic certificate for registration or licensing. This is particularly relevant for fields such as medication, law, and engineering.
Immigration:
Many countries utilize the IELTS Academic test as part of their immigration procedures. A high score can assist people satisfy the language requirements for visa applications and irreversible residency.
Employment Opportunities:
An IELTS Academic certificate can be an important asset in the task market, specifically for positions that need strong English language abilities. It demonstrates a prospect's ability to communicate efficiently in an academic and expert context.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How long is the IELTS Academic test?
The overall test duration is 2 hours and 45 minutes. The Listening section is 30 minutes, the Reading area is 60 minutes, the Writing area is 60 minutes, and the Speaking area is 11-14 minutes.
Q2: How is the IELTS Academic test scored?
The test is scored on a scale of 0 to 9, with 9 being the greatest. Each area (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king) is scored individually, and the total band score is the average of these four ratings.
Q3: How long are IELTS ratings valid?
IELTS scores stand for two years from the date of the test. Nevertheless, some organizations might have their own policies relating to the credibility of scores.
